On the move: a new Rome office for BonelliErede
19 December 2016

BonelliErede’s team in Rome moved to the historical Palazzo Menotti at 39 Via Vittoria Colonna today – just a stone’s throw away from the Supreme Court. Designed by the 19th century entrepreneur and politician Carlo Menotti, the namesake building is in the heart of one of the oldest neighbourhoods in Rome.

The new 4,000 sqm office combines tradition with innovation: it is housed in Palazzo Menotti, one of the best examples of Italian artistic heritage of between the IX and XX centuries and is complemented with innovative design – including spaces with table football and TVs for the team to take a break and spend time together. The new office is also equipped with a fleet of BonelliErede branded bikes available to all. Branded bikes will also soon be introduced at the firm’s other offices.

The Rome team also has a new leader: Andrea Silvestri, coordinator of the firm’s tax practice, has taken over the reins from Claudio Tesauro as head of the Rome office – which now counts 73 professionals (including 8 partners) and 21 support staff.
